The dunefield is nested inside the Tularosa Basin, which is surrounded from the San Andres and the Sacramento Mountains. These mountains are composed of layers of gypsum. Rainfall and snowmelt from these mountains dissolve the gypsum and clean it right down to basin’s floor. Listed here it's got nowhere to go, much like a bathtub or sink without any drain. The drinking water settles to the basin ground at its least expensive level, known as Lake Lucero. When climatic conditions are optimum, the h2o evaporates, as well as the dissolved minerals recrystallize and sort selenite crystals. Selenite would be the crystalline sort of gypsum. These crystals are quite brittle and fragile. Selenite can variety huge crystals—some as significant as bicycle tires! Visitors to the park can see selenite crystals on hikes to Lake Lucero.

Gypsum's journey commences in environments the place h2o rich in dissolved calcium and sulfate ions undergoes evaporation. Given that the h2o disappears, the ions develop into concentrated and finally precipitate out as gypsum crystals.
Desert Playas: Gypsum is commonly found in desert playas, that are flat, arid regions that sometimes fill with h2o but then evaporate, leaving behind a crust of assorted minerals, like gypsum.
Agricultural and Industrial Byproducts: Synthetic gypsum, created as a byproduct in industrial processes like coal combustion as well as the manufacture of phosphoric acid, is Employed in numerous purposes, together with development and agriculture.

The water content material in gypsum is important to its one of a kind Attributes and flexibility. When gypsum is heated, it undergoes a system called calcination, during which it loses some or all of its drinking water information, with regards to the temperature and duration of heating.
Gypsum is known for its softness and will be conveniently scratched gypsum having a fingernail. Its Actual physical visual appearance can differ from clear and colorless to white, gray, brown, or perhaps pink, depending on impurities present within the mineral.

Extremely generally it truly is fashioned from your hydration of anhydrite by area waters and groundwaters, and, Consequently, quite a few gypsiferous strata quality downward into anhydrite rocks. This alternative leads to a thirty % to 50 p.c volume maximize and results in extreme, tight folding on the remaining anhydrite levels. Gypsum also takes place disseminated in limestones, dolomitic limestones, and some shales.
